USD Coin (USDC) is a type of stablecoin — a cryptocurrency designed to maintain a stable value by being pegged to a traditional currency, in this case, the U.S. dollar. Here's a concise overview:

USDC (USD Coin) is a digital dollar backed 1:1 by U.S. dollar reserves or equivalent assets.

It is issued by Centre Consortium, founded by Circle and Coinbase.

Each USDC token is supposed to be redeemable for $1 USD, making it relatively stable compared to volatile c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in or Ethereum.

Stable Value Pegged 1:1 to USD to reduce volatility.

Transparency Reserves are regularly audited by independent firms.

Blockchain Use Runs on multiple blockchains: Ethereum (ERC-20), Solana, Avalanche, etc.

Use Cases Trading, remittances, DeFi, payments, and as a hedge against crypto volatility.
